Output 7138074ea7dd11fa032936a80a60d4ca8a1d81c7d87605e353558b8c86f19407:92

value
8838389
script pubkey
OP_0 OP_PUSHBYTES_20 3da50c3bfe4d195fcbb360452394668613766ca7
address
bc1q8kjscwl7f5v4ljanvpzj89rxscfhvm98j830sr
transaction
7138074ea7dd11fa032936a80a60d4ca8a1d81c7d87605e353558b8c86f19407